Exciting New Senior Living Community (Independent Living, Assisted Living and Memory Care) Now Open! The Director of Plant Operations is a key member of the Leadership Team – as they model our culture of hospitality and oversee all care and maintenance of the Community’s physical plant.

The Director of Plant Operations is responsible for maintaining an effective preventative maintenance program; the hiring, training and supervising of all plant and housekeeping employees; the coordinating of life safety and security programs; the procuring of supplies, material and equipment, and assisting with budget preparation and operating within budgetary guidelines. The candidate will report to the Executive Director and will provide hands-on full scope management of the community maintenance and housekeeping programs while upholding the Community’s mission, philosophy, values and the Company’s vision, principles and Hospitality Promises.

Here are a few of the qualifications we need you to have:

· Associates Degree or equivalent in relevant education, training, and experience

· Minimum three years’ experience as a maintenance supervisor in a similarly sized facility

· One year or more experience in apartment and/or healthcare community maintenance

· Must possess current and valid driver’s license consistent with the requirements determined by size of vehicle and laws of the state in which the driver is licensed

· Willingness to be available for any/all emergencies regarding the community

· Must have thorough understanding of all building systems and their interdependence

· May require extensive math and electrical background based on size and complexity of facility

· Be able to conduct independent assessments of a contractor’s compliance with requirements of Scope of Work

· Possess financial management practices and the application of contractor resources to meet commitments to the quality, safety, cost, and schedule of systems

· Have the ability to contract provisions necessary to provide oversight of a contractor’s performance

· Conduct independent assessments of the contractor’s maintenance training and qualification program

· Good communication skills (oral and written)

· Good inter-department communication and teamwork skills

· Capable of administering employee incentive, retention and training programs

· Familiarity with Microsoft Office Suite products
